directions

  • In a small mixing bowl add minced garlic, olive oil, vinegar, and also the zest and juice of the lemons and orange. Set aside dressing.
  • Place finely chopped cabbage, onion, and watercress in large mixing bowl. Pour half of the dressing over coleslaw, season with salt and pepper, and toss well to coat. Add more dressing as desired.
